The Mediterranean fever treatment market in Australia is growing due to the increasing awareness and diagnosis of familial Mediterranean fever (FMF) among patients. FMF is a hereditary inflammatory disorder that primarily affects individuals of Mediterranean descent, though it can occur in other populations as well. Treatments for FMF focus on reducing inflammation and preventing flare-ups. The demand for effective treatment options, including colchicine and other anti-inflammatory drugs, is rising as the condition is better recognized by healthcare professionals. With improved diagnostic capabilities and ongoing research into alternative treatments, the Mediterranean fever treatment market in Australia is expected to experience continued growth.
The Mediterranean fever treatment market in Australia is evolving as a response to the increasing diagnosis of Mediterranean Fever (Familial Mediterranean Fever or FMF), especially among the population with Mediterranean ancestry. FMF is a hereditary condition characterized by recurrent fever and inflammation, and as awareness of the disease grows, there is an increased demand for effective treatment options. The market is primarily driven by the need for therapies that manage symptoms, reduce inflammation, and prevent long-term complications, such as amyloidosis. The growth in this market is also fueled by advancements in biologic drugs, which are increasingly being used to treat the condition, along with the availability of genetic testing to help with early diagnosis. Additionally, there is a growing focus on developing personalized treatments that can target the underlying genetic causes of FMF, improving patient outcomes.

Familial Mediterranean Fever (FMF) is a rare genetic condition, and the Australian government facilitates access to treatments through the Pharmaceutical Benefits Scheme (PBS) and other support programs. The TGA oversees the approval of medications used in FMF treatment, ensuring they meet safety and efficacy standards. Specialist healthcare services and genetic counseling are supported to manage and treat FMF effectively. The government`s policies aim to provide comprehensive care for individuals with rare diseases like FMF.?
